Duties and responsibilities
You will be working as a Renal Dialysis Nurse and will be responsible for the following duties;

  • Developing and overseeing care plans for renal patients
  • Ensuring clinical activities are meticulously documented
  • Reviewing pre and post- haemodialysis care with patients
  • Preparing and monitoring dialysis machines and systems
  • Working closely within a multi-disciplinary team
  • Working on a 1:4 nurse to patient ratio to ensure time to provide holistic care
